Hej! >Jag testar en shop gjord av pc för alla. Men de använder inte något dsn namn.Global.asa
Har kört fast lite här!
Skulle mer än gärna ta emot lite hjälp!
Jag har en databas som har ett tilldelat dsn namn som är = data
Jag testar en shop gjord av pc för alla. Men de använder inte något dsn namn.
så här står det nu!
<SCRIPT LANGUAGE=VBScript RUNAT=Server>
Sub Application_OnStart
Application("shopdata") = "driver={\aspshop\data\shop.mdb")End Sub
Sub Session_OnEnd
' ==========================================================================
' Radera besökarens korg när han/hon lämnar sajten.
' Endast ofullständiga besrtällningar kommer att raderas.
' ==========================================================================
On Error Resume Next
Set Connection = Server.CreateObject("ADODB.Connection")
Connection.Open Application("shopdata")
SQLStmt = "DELETE FROM Korg Where AnvId =" & Session.SessionId & " AND Spara <> 1"
Connection.Execute(SQLStmt)
Connection.Close
End Sub
Sub Application_OnEnd
' ==========================================================================
' Om servern tas ned är det lika bra att vi raderar alla poster i korgen
' som är ofullständiga för att rensa upp databasen.
' ==========================================================================
On Error Resume Next
Set Connection = Server.CreateObject("ADODB.Connection")
Connection.Open Application("shopdata")
SQLStmt = "DELETE FROM Korg Where Spara <> 1"
Connection.Execute(SQLStmt)
Connection.Close
End Sub
</SCRIPT>
Kör jag med min dsn-koppling så funkar ju allt, men inte detta! Eftersom jag inte skriver: Connection.Open Application("shopdata")
när jag ska köra mot databasen utan:Connection.Open "data"
Och det medför ju att cookies inte rensas när de lämnar butiken!
Så frågan är hur ändrar jag i ovanstående för att jag kan fortsätta skriva mot min egna koppling?
RikardSv: Global.asa
Har du tänkt på att det kanske är just därför de inte använder DSN??
Gör som de har gjort så funkar det i alla fall.
//Mikael
- Man frälser inte världen med webshopar -